Here is what can happen though, if your mom claims that she never co-signed the note and the signature is not hers the creditor will have her sign an affidavit to that extent. The creditor then can proceed against you civilly and criminally to protect its interests. Most likely that is what will happen. Depending on the amount of the loan it could be a felony charge, you should immediately seek legal representation in order to protect yourself. Potentially this kind of stuff falls under the statute of fraud and thereby you could be subject to that. I suggest that you work this out with your mother to prevent this from becoming a nightmare.

Einstein was already living in the US when Hitler came to power in 1933 though he had planned to return to take up a position there. His being "kicked out" of Germany was therefore symbolic. He never returned to Germany. He became a US citizen in 1940.
